I had to transfer to another cable car midway and this is where it really starts to go higher up. The cable cars were clearly much larger here, the size of a small bus versus the more personal cable car that I took from Ortisei. This time, I think there was only one car going one direction. There are two cable ways but they dedicate to one car each, so they just go up and down all the time. Since the cars are so much larger, more people can fit inside and fit they did. There were a lot of people waiting to board the car and they were all in full winter sports gear. I must be the only one there who brought a large camera along.
